The table below shows the detached home sales for select cities in Coachella Valley for the month of June 2022.
Since Short Term Rentals are still allowed in Indio (for detached homes without HOAs), there has been a surge of interest in Indio—especially those properties with private pools. Indio also enjoys the benefits of being served by IID rather than SCE. This month it is the only city here that has a higher average selling price than asking price.
The final sales prices for these seven towns ranged from a low of $210,000 for 83128 Ruby Avenue in Indio, to a high of $12,750,000 for 81850 Baffin Avenue in La Quinta.

City | # of homes sold | Average Days on Market | Average ORIGINAL Asking Price | Average FINAL Selling Price | Lowest Selling Price | Highest Selling Price |
Bermuda Dunes | 12 | 30 | $964,333 | $904,141 | $489,000 | $2,100,000 |
Cathedral City | 31 | 25 | $564,258 | $563,273 | $285,000 | $1,150,000 |
Indian Wells | 13 | 17 | $1,985,608 | $1,966,538 | $975,000 | $3,575,000 |
Indio | 98 | 27 | $648,305 | $661,970 | $210,000 | $1,699,000 |
La Quinta | 77 | 36 | $1,398,268 | $1,334,958 | $375,000 | $12,750,000 |
Palm Desert | 87 | 31 | $1,007,632 | $979,450 | $352,000 | $8,700,000 |
Palm Springs | 49 | 30 | $1,163,804 | $1,162,749 | $455,000 | $3,100,000 |
Rancho Mirage | 33 | 27 | $1,460,513 | $1,451,923 | $575,000 | $4,500,000 |
Please note that the original asking prices and the days on market do not reflect when a home has been previously listed. This information is only pertinent for the listings that actually sold in this particular month.
